Did Giants' Ninth Inning Rally Fall Short Against Dodgers?
The San Francisco Giants faced off against the Los Angeles Dodgers at Oracle Park in a game that extended into extra innings. The Giants, with a record of 52-45, were unable to secure a victory against the Dodgers, who improved their standing to 58-39. The final score was 5-2 in favor of the Dodgers.

Giants' Willy Adames Ready to Shine Against Athletics at Sutter Health Park
As the Giants prepare to face off against the Athletics at Sutter Health Park, all eyes are on Willy Adames, the shortstop who has been a standout performer for the Orange and Black. In their recent games against the Diamondbacks, Adames showcased his prowess with a batting average of .750 in one game, accompanied by an impressive on-base percentage of .800 and a slugging percentage of 1.250. His performance in that game was nothing short of exceptional, as he managed to maintain a flawless fielding percentage as well.
